> Infact I tried using XalanJ 2.5.0 when this posting/discussion was going
> one, but it started giving an error
> java.lang.ClassNotFoundException:
> org/apache/xml/dtm/ref/IncrementalSAXSource_Xerces
> when I have XalanJ2.5.0 related jar files xalan.jar, xml-apis.jar
> and xercesImpl.jar. If I dont have these in classpath, java is
> picking up the XSLT processor shipped with JDK's JRE i.e., rt.jar.
> If I remove this file, JVM is not able to start :-( I guess, am
> sidetracked from the original problem :-( Is there anyway to findout
> what version of XSLT processor is used/shipped with JDK 1.4.x?

I've run into this problem too; it's very frustrating. It's covered in
the Xalan-J FAQ at:

  http://xml.apache.org/xalan-j/faq.html#faq-N100CB

I've used the -Xbootclasspath option and it works fine.
